Job summary

Parkside House School in Ashington is seeking a dedicated Maths Teacher to join its specialist team from September 2026. The role is permanent and term-time-only, based at the Ashington site (NE63 8AP) with a salary up to £44,000 per annum depending on experience.

You will deliver engaging maths lessons, tailor learning for pupils with autism and learning difficulties, monitor progress and contribute to curriculum development in a nurturing, inclusive setting.

Qualifications

  • QTS or a relevant degree in Mathematics.
  • Passion for inspiring young people and making a genuine difference.
  • Experience of, or willingness to develop expertise in, supporting pupils with autism, learning difficulties or additional needs.
  • Creative, adaptable and able to tailor learning to individual pupils.
  • Strong communication skills and the ability to work collaboratively within a team.
  • Calm, patient and resilient, with the capacity to build positive relationships and motivate learners.
  • Commitment to safeguarding and promoting the welfare of children and young people.

Responsibilities

  • Deliver high-quality, creative Maths lessons that inspire curiosity and achievement.
  • Plan and adapt learning to meet the individual needs of pupils with autism and additional learning difficulties.
  • Monitor, assess and celebrate pupil progress, using assessment to inform future planning.
  • Create a positive, nurturing and inclusive classroom environment.
  • Support pupils’ academic, social and emotional development through strong relationships and personalised approaches.
  • Contribute to the development of the Maths curriculum and whole-school improvement.
  • Collaborate effectively with teaching assistants, therapists, families and colleagues.
